Mahabharata Shanti Parva – सत्ययज्ञा दमयज्ञा अलुब्धाश चात्मतृप्तयः

Shloka (श्लोक)
सत्ययज्ञा दमयज्ञा अलुब्धाश चात्मतृप्तयः
उत्पन्न तयागिनः सर्वे जना आसन्न मत्सराः
⚡ Quick Meaning
Those who practice truthfulness, self-control, and contentment do not harbor envy and have fully realized the essence of sacrifice.
Translations
English Translation
This verse portrays individuals who engage in truthful endeavors, practice self-restraint, and find fulfillment within themselves. Their inner peace and generosity prevent feelings of jealousy from arising.

Commentary
Context
Located in the Shanti Parva, this shloka highlights the virtues critical to achieving higher states of being and wisdom.
Meaning
It emphasizes that true liberation comes when one adheres to truth, self-discipline, and contentment, free from the petty emotions that spark conflict.
Application
Each individual can benefit from cultivating these virtues as they pave the way for not only personal growth but also harmonious relationships with others.
